Stock Market Trends 2025: Opportunities and Risks.

2025 has not been kind to the Indian stock market and traders. The Nifty 50 index has fallen into a 10% decline from its recent peak. With a projected GDP growth of 6.5–7%, fueled by digital transformation, infrastructure expansion, and a youthful demographic, the Indian market is ripe for strategic investing. However, navigating this landscape requires a keen understanding of emerging trends, sectoral dynamics, and risks. Here’s your guide to thriving in India’s 2025 stock market:

RBI
  • Interest Rates & Inflation: The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) may maintain a cautious stance, balancing inflation control (targeting 4–6%) with growth. A stable repo rate could boost corporate borrowing, benefiting sectors like infrastructure and real estate.
  • Global Growth: Slowdowns in the US or EU might dampen exports, but India’s domestic consumption-driven economy offers resilience. Foreign Institutional Investor (FII) flows will hinge on US Fed rate decisions and India’s growth premium.
  • Rupee Volatility: A weaker INR could pressure import-heavy sectors (e.g., oil) but boost IT and pharma exports.

2. Sectoral Shifts: Green Energy, EVs, and Digital Domination

  • Green Energy Boom: India’s push for 500 GW renewable capacity by 2030 will accelerate solar, wind, and hydrogen investments. Companies like Adani Green and Tata Power are key players.
  • E-commerce & Digital Payments – Online retail and fintech innovations will remain in focus, especially with continued digital transformation.
  • Biotech & Pharma: Post-pandemic innovation and generic drug dominance position India as a global biotech hub. Watch Dr. Reddy’s and Biocon.
  • Digital Services: Fintech (Paytm, PhonePe), AI, and SaaS startups will benefit from India’s tech-savvy population.
  • Struggling Sectors: Traditional energy (coal), non-essential imports, and highly leveraged industries may lag.

3. Retail Investors: The New Market Powerhouse

  • Meme Stocks & Social Media: While SEBI tightens regulations on misinformation, Telegram/Youtube-driven speculation may persist. Caution advised.
  • SIP Mania: Systematic Investment Plans (SIPs) in mutual funds could cross ₹25,000 crore/month, stabilizing markets amid volatility.

4. Technological Disruptions: Blockchain and AI

  • Digital Rupee (CBDC): RBI’s CBDC rollout could streamline settlements and enable fractional asset ownership.
  • AI in Trading: Algorithmic trading and robo-advisors (e.g., Smallcase) will gain traction among retail investors.
  • Fintech Integration: UPI’s expansion into stock investing and insurtech will blur banking and market boundaries.

5. ESG Investing: From Niche to Mainstream

  • Regulatory Push: SEBI’s ESG disclosure norms and green bond frameworks will drive compliance. Companies like Tata and Reliance are leading with net-zero pledges.
  • Investor Demand: Millennials and institutional investors are prioritizing ESG ETFs and green infrastructure funds. Beware of greenwashing!

6. Risks to Watch: Geopolitics and Valuations

  • Market Corrections: Elevated P/E ratios in mid- and small-caps signal potential corrections. Focus on fundamentals.
  • Geopolitical Tensions: India-China border issues or Middle East conflicts could disrupt supply chains and oil prices (~$90/barrel).
  • 2024 Elections: Policy continuity hinges on election outcomes; infrastructure and welfare schemes may face delays.
  • Black Swans: Climate events (monsoon variability) or pandemics could hit rural consumption and healthcare stocks.

7. Investment Strategies for 2025

  • Diversify Smartly: Blend growth sectors (green energy, EVs) with defensives (FMCG, pharma).
  • SIPs & Large-Caps: Use SIPs to mitigate volatility; large-caps (HDFC Bank, Infosys) offer stability.
  • Thematic Bets: Explore PLI scheme beneficiaries (electronics, textiles) and 5G infrastructure plays (Bharti Airtel).
  • Hedge Risks: Allocate to gold ETFs or global equities (via LRS) to diversify currency risks.

Conclusion

For investors willing to navigate this complex landscape with thorough research and risk management, the Indian market continues to offer one of the most attractive long-term investment destinations globally.
